Official scientific title |
MODERATE ISCHEMIC MITRAL REGURGE: REVASCULARIZATION ALONE VERSUS REVASCULARIZATION AND MITRAL VALVE REPAIR |
Brief summary describing the background
and objectives of the trial
|
Ischemic mitral regurgitation (IMR) is a common finding following myocardial infarction or ischemia. Management of moderate IMR is still a hot topic. Adding mitral valve repair (MVr) to co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) is questionable.The goal of this study was to assess and compare short term clinical and echocardiographic results of moderate IMR treated by CABG alone versus another group of patients treated by CABG plus MVr.
